AI Technical Summary
Ammonia-free elastic fabrics are prone to problems such as color spots, color differences, edge wrinkles, claw marks, and color creases during the dyeing process. Existing technologies are difficult to effectively control the dyeing rate and uniformity, resulting in unstable dyeing quality.
A high-temperature acid-adjusting dyeing method is adopted, with temperature and pH value controlled in stages. The uniform feeding rate is achieved by adjusting the valve opening in real time. Combined with the use of dispersants and leveling agents, the dyeing process is optimized to ensure that the dye enters the fiber uniformly.
It effectively reduces color spots, color differences and wrinkles during the dyeing process, improves dyeing uniformity and quality stability, and enhances the color fastness of dyed fabrics.
